What is the e signature lawfulness for insurance industry in united states

The eSignature lawfulness in the United States is governed by the Electronic Signatures in Global and National Commerce Act (ESIGN) and the Uniform Electronic Transactions Act (UETA). These laws establish that electronic signatures hold the same legal weight as traditional handwritten signatures, provided certain conditions are met. In the insurance industry, this means that contracts, policy documents, and claims can be signed electronically, streamlining processes and enhancing efficiency.

For an eSignature to be considered lawful, it must be associated with the intent to sign, be unique to the signer, and be created using a method that is under the sole control of the signer. This legal framework allows insurance companies to adopt electronic signatures for various documents while ensuring compliance with federal and state regulations.

Key elements of the e signature lawfulness for insurance industry in united states

Several key elements define the lawfulness of eSignatures in the insurance industry. These include:

  • Intent to sign: Signers must demonstrate their intention to sign the document electronically.
  • Consent: All parties must agree to the use of electronic signatures.
  • Security: The eSignature method must ensure the integrity and confidentiality of the signed document.
  • Record retention: Organizations must maintain records of signed documents in compliance with applicable laws.

By adhering to these elements, insurance companies can ensure the legality and effectiveness of their eSignature processes.

Security & Compliance Guidelines

Security and compliance are paramount when implementing eSignatures in the insurance industry. To ensure compliance with legal standards, organizations should adopt the following guidelines:

  • Utilize a secure eSignature platform that encrypts data during transmission and storage.
  • Implement multi-factor authentication to verify the identity of signers.
  • Maintain an audit trail that records all actions taken on the document, including timestamps and IP addresses.
  • Regularly review and update security protocols to align with evolving regulations and best practices.

By following these guidelines, insurance companies can protect sensitive information while maintaining compliance with eSignature laws.

Examples of using the e signature lawfulness for insurance industry in united states

In the insurance industry, eSignatures can be utilized in various scenarios, including:

  • Policy applications: Customers can complete and sign insurance applications online, expediting the onboarding process.
  • Claims submissions: Policyholders can submit claims and sign necessary documents electronically, reducing processing time.
  • Renewal agreements: Insurance companies can send renewal agreements for eSignature, streamlining the renewal process.
  • Disclosure documents: Insurers can provide and obtain signatures on required disclosures electronically, ensuring compliance.

These examples illustrate how eSignatures enhance operational efficiency and improve customer experience in the insurance sector.
